A dream illusive, a nifty title
Frame to frame through thought to thought
And caring to much of feeble disregards
But wait, look at this from a distance

Stand where I stand, do as I do
Gaze upon this meaningless splendor
It’s a tree, dead and forgotten
A perfect metaphor for joy

Can you hope to shed your light
Honestly be the being, of your meant destiny
A meant purpose for worldly things
Do you think you can shed a light
Because I can, and I will
All I have to do is get up and flick the switch

This my friend, is a dream illusive
